Abstract
The family of chalcogenide rhenium clusters is well represented in the literature by a series of compounds with different nuclearities, including heterometallic complexes. Here we report the synthesis and detailed characterization of new cyanide clusters [{Re8Se8(µ-O)3}(CN)18]8– and [{Re12S14}(CN)27]9–. Both compounds were obtained by reactions of ReI3, RuCl3 and elemental selenium or sulfur with KCN at elevated temperatures, reflecting attempts to prepare heterometallic complexes with noble metals. The first cluster can be visualized as two fragments [{Re4Se4}(CN)9]– linked by three µ-O2– bridging ligands. The second one can be represented as three tetrahedral [{Re4S4}(CN)9]– fragments linked by two µ3-bridged sulfide ligands. Two of three {Re4S4} cores are additionally linked by direct Re–Re bond.
